Understanding the VMware infrastructure The following components comprise the VMware infrastructure: • Virtual machine—A virtual machine is a software-based computer capable of running an operating system such as Microsoft® Windows® or GNU/Linux as if the operating system is installed on a physical machine. • Host—A host is a physical machine running platform virtualization software such as ESXi. Hosts provide processor, memory, storage, and network resources for one or more virtual machines.
• Management network—A management network enables the server administrator to manage discrete physical servers without relying on a general purpose communications network. This dedicated network enables a reliable connection to the hardware in the event of a failure in the general purpose network. • Virtual machine communication network—A virtual machine communication network is built on the traditional, general purpose communication network.
